Hi,

My washing machine, which has had no problems before, has stopped working. When I press the start button (after the machine has been turned on) nothing happens except the light next to the 3h symbol goes green. If I press start again that light flashes (which means it has paused I think). I've made sure the door is closed properly but bar that I don't know what to do.

I literally no nothing about washing machine at all! I've attached a picture.

Please help! Thanks!

Hello there. This fault could be caused by many different things. It ideally wants troubleshooting by an engineer with access to test meters etc. Commonly this fault can be caused by a faulty door lock, but it could also be caused if the door lock is okay but a connection or mechanical problem on the door catch prevents it being operated properly. On Indesit washing machines they can also go completely dead but with some lights working if the motor goes open circuit. That is most commonly caused by worn carbon brushes. But of course it could be various other things.
